862.20235/10–2445: Telegram
The Chargé in Argentina (Cabot) to the Secretary of State
[Received October 24—7:36 p.m.]
2650. Re Embassy telegram 2560, October 16, 8 p.m. and despatch 1102, October 17.67 Osmar Hellmuth and Andrés Blay Pigrau arrived in Buenos Aires yesterday and were promptly arrested by Argentine police authorities. Federal police asked Legal Attaché today for adverse information against Pigrau whom they consider deporting to Paraguay.
Ernest Hoppe and Oscar Liehr due arrive October 27.
On October 22 British Embassy notified Argentine Foreign Office these persons are self-confessed Nazi agents detained under special wartime regulations recently expired; that it was impossible for British to try them as their offenses were committed outside British jurisdiction; and asked that steps be taken by Argentina to insure they do not engage again in pro-Nazi activities or espionage.
Publicity covering return of Hellmuth thus far confined to factual report of return and review of his pro-Nazis activities.
In view of Argentine action I am merely urging Foreign Office to take measures against these spies under Argentine law.
